Driver training
The continued development of our drivers is vital and we have adopted a pro-active approach to the national drivers' skills shortage.
We are an Institute of Advance Motorists (IAM) accredited training company. Advanced driving is part of our driving culture. All our sites have a driving assessor, qualified through the Institute of Advanced Motorists (IAM), responsible for developing road risk strategies and implementing best practice processes for all our drivers.
We have introduced a Young Driver Scheme which is open to anybody between the ages of 17 to 21. Both new and existing employees have the opportunity to gain and an NVQ level 2 in Driving Goods Vehicles and a "C" category driver's licence.

IS training
Our Information Systems trainers deliver a suite of Microsoft Office packages including Word, Excel and Powerpoint.
They also support the business with in-house bespoke packages designed to assist with the management of our transport and warehouse operations.
For new business implementations the IS trainers are an integral part of the team from an early stage. They learn the system, design the training material and ultimately deliver classroom and on-the-job training.
